> Hi Robert- Jersey 1.x uses java.util.logging, the logging system bundled
> into the java runtime. If you don't like JUL (who does?) I was able to
> successfully use slf4j (http://www.slf4j.org/ <
> http://www.slf4j.org/legacy.**html <http://www.slf4j.org/legacy.html>>)
> and its legacy package for JUL (http://www.slf4j.org/legacy.**html<http://www.slf4j.org/legacy.html>) to capture the Jersey 1.x logs into another framework. Hope this helps.
